Renommage du package suite au renommage du repo + màj des dépendances
This commit is contained in:
parent
b1215d2658
commit
8514310cf8
15
README.md
15
README.md
|
@ -1,10 +1,10 @@
|
||||||
# readline
|
# greadline
|
||||||
|
|
||||||
Readline est un prompt Linux qui se veut similaire à C readline mais en ligne de commande.
|
Greadline est un prompt Linux qui se veut similaire à C readline mais en ligne de commande.
|
||||||
|
|
||||||
## Utilisation typique
|
## Utilisation typique
|
||||||
|
|
||||||
readline peut être utilisé de la façon suivante :
|
Greadline peut être utilisé de la façon suivante :
|
||||||
|
|
||||||
```go
|
```go
|
||||||
package main
|
package main
|
||||||
|
@ -12,13 +12,13 @@ package main
|
||||||
import (
|
import (
|
||||||
"fmt"
|
"fmt"
|
||||||
"os"
|
"os"
|
||||||
"gitea.zaclys.net/bvaudour/readline"
|
"gitea.zaclys.net/bvaudour/greadline"
|
||||||
)
|
)
|
||||||
|
|
||||||
func main() {
|
func main() {
|
||||||
prompt := "\033[1;31m> \033[m"
|
prompt := "\033[1;31m> \033[m"
|
||||||
rl := readline.New()
|
rl := greadline.New()
|
||||||
defer readline.Close()
|
defer greadline.Close()
|
||||||
for {
|
for {
|
||||||
input := rl.Prompt(prompt) // rl.PromptPassword(prompt) pour masquer ce qui est saisi
|
input := rl.Prompt(prompt) // rl.PromptPassword(prompt) pour masquer ce qui est saisi
|
||||||
if result, ok := input.Ok(); ok {
|
if result, ok := input.Ok(); ok {
|
||||||
|
@ -61,6 +61,3 @@ func main() {
|
||||||
| Ctrl+Y | Copie le dernier élément supprimé |
|
| Ctrl+Y | Copie le dernier élément supprimé |
|
||||||
| Alt+Y | Remonte dans l’historique des éléments supprimés et les copie (implique Ctrl+Y précédemment lancé) |
|
| Alt+Y | Remonte dans l’historique des éléments supprimés et les copie (implique Ctrl+Y précédemment lancé) |
|
||||||
| Ctrl+G, Cancel | Annule les dernières actions temporaires (historique, recherche, copie, historique de copie) |
|
| Ctrl+G, Cancel | Annule les dernières actions temporaires (historique, recherche, copie, historique de copie) |
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
4
go.mod
4
go.mod
|
@ -1,5 +1,5 @@
|
||||||
module gitea.zaclys.com/bvaudour/readline
|
module gitea.zaclys.com/bvaudour/geadline
|
||||||
|
|
||||||
go 1.22
|
go 1.22
|
||||||
|
|
||||||
require gitea.zaclys.com/bvaudour/gob v0.0.0-20240225133050-ec6a3ba492cc
|
require gitea.zaclys.com/bvaudour/gob v0.0.0-20240302132617-3307dec97ce9
|
||||||
|
|
4
go.sum
4
go.sum
|
@ -1,2 +1,2 @@
|
||||||
gitea.zaclys.com/bvaudour/gob v0.0.0-20240225133050-ec6a3ba492cc h1:taHLOnrgyIlGYSs9cu+FXChAYtIeHoJg2D8to+UDgoA=
|
gitea.zaclys.com/bvaudour/gob v0.0.0-20240302132617-3307dec97ce9 h1:rWwHju2jTBu/V7ALO9tYiNJOqqanEDEpfAtNUDGrImQ=
|
||||||
gitea.zaclys.com/bvaudour/gob v0.0.0-20240225133050-ec6a3ba492cc/go.mod h1:Gw6x0KNKoXv6AMtRkaI+iWM2enVzwHikUSskuEzWQz4=
|
gitea.zaclys.com/bvaudour/gob v0.0.0-20240302132617-3307dec97ce9/go.mod h1:Gw6x0KNKoXv6AMtRkaI+iWM2enVzwHikUSskuEzWQz4=
|
||||||
|
|
|
@ -1,4 +1,4 @@
|
||||||
package readline
|
package greadline
|
||||||
|
|
||||||
import (
|
import (
|
||||||
"os"
|
"os"
|
||||||
|
|
Loading…
Reference in New Issue